Excelsior (shredded wood) when dry, clean and free from oil.

Exothermic ferrochrome.... Exothermic ferromanganese. Exothermic silicon-chrome.

Feed, wet, mixed......

Ferrophosphorus......

The hazard connected with the shipment of empty drums or barrels that previously contained any dangerous article lies in the possible presence of residue contents in the drum or barrel. No marking required.

Packing and cushioning material made from wood or cellulose.

Protect from sparks or open flame. Reject wet or insecurely packed consignments.

Do not stow in proximity to vegetable or animal oils, paints, corrosive liquids (white label) or oxidizing materials (yellow label).

No marking required.

Gray or brown colored, hard, brittle solid. Mechanical, coherent mixture of the two metals with small amounts of oxidizers and bonding agents.

Produces no hazardous conditions in contact with water.

When heated to temperatures of 662° F. (350° C.) will burn briskly at a bright red heat and is difficult to extinguish with water or steam smothering system. Outside containers shall be marked "Exothermic ferrochrome", "Exothermic ferromanganese", or "Exothermic silicon-chrome", as the case may be. Prepared animal feeds which usually con sist of mixtures of molasses with ground alfalfa hay. Some may contain grains such as cracked corn and oats, others contain finely divided products such as cottonseed meal, linseed meal, middlings, bran, etc.

Moisture if permitted to contact this material may cause spontaneous heating and possible ignition.

Stow in cool, dry and well ventilated compartment. Do not stow bags over ten tiers high without flooring off. Do not overstow. Outside containers shall be marked either "Feed, wet, mixed" or "Hazardous article."

Alloys of iron and phosphorus.

May evolve poisonous gas in contact with moisture.

Stow well away from living quarters. Keep dry.

Outside containers shall be marked either "Ferrophosphorus" or "Hazardous article".

No label required.
